Vivian Louise “Taylor” Anderson Fecker was born April 1, 1930, in Sikeston, Mo. to William T. Taylor and Nannie Adelaide Taylor, and passed away May 15, 2023, at her home surrounded by family.

Vivian and KC Anderson were married on November 25, 1946, spending 33 wonderful years together before his death in 1980.

She was a member of Concord Baptist Church, Concord, Arkansas.

She is preceded in death by her parents, her husband and father of her children, K. C. Anderson, her second husband, Joseph Fecker, a sister, Bettie Lou Taylor, three brothers, William A. Taylor, James
Taylor and Donald Taylor, and two grandsons, Kevin Anderson and Timothy Anderson.

Vivian is survived by three sons, Bradford Glen Anderson of Batesville, David Anderson and wife, Karen, of Newport, Danny Anderson and wife, Charlene, of Concord, three daughters, Kathy King and husband, Clifford of Cabot, Janice Howell of Concord, and Sherri Gansz and husband, Richard of Lincoln, 17 Grandchildren, 30 Great Grandchildren and 3 Great Great Grandchildren.

She is known for her “chicken & dumplings, raising a garden and growing all kinds of flowers, sewing, quilting and her love for her family. Her favorite saying to each family member was “I love you and you’re precious” ensuring each person felt special.
